Risk of Stroke Hospitalization After Infertility Treatment
IMPORTANCE: Stroke accounts for 7% of pregnancy-related deaths in the US. As the use of infertility treatment is increasing, many studies have sought to characterize the association of infertility treatment with the risk of stroke with mixed results.
